Question:
These are special kinds of groups and its members often have complementary skills and are committed to a common goal or purpose. Members are mutually accountable for their activities. There is a positive synergy attained through the coordinated efforts of the members. Which of the following is being referred to here?
Options:
Group
Team
Crowd
Group or Team
Correct Answer:
Team
Explanation:
Teams are special kinds of groups. Members of teams often have complementary skills and are committed to a common goal or purpose. Members are mutually accountable for their activities. In teams, there is a positive synergy attained through the coordinated efforts of the members.
